WACO, Texas — Whether you're from the Lone Star State or not, watching horses clip-clop through city streets might catch you off guard. But that's exactly what Kenneth Bible is banking on with his unique approach to tourism in the heart of Texas-- guided trail rides through Downtown Waco.

"They're their own billboards, so they garner a lot of attention," Bible said. "We get a lot of people just stopping like they're exotic animals, taking pictures and things."

Bible is the owner of K-Bible's Guided Trail Rides, a family-run business that offers horseback tours throughout Waco. While some cities have walking tours or guided bike rides, Bible decided to think bigger — because this is Texas, after all.
